Transaction aebc52e07144adc102733b6d43dae6baf95175ce7f4ff68340fd427c88f27748

15 Input
2 Outputs
  • aebc52e07144adc102733b6d43dae6baf95175ce7f4ff68340fd427c88f27748:0
  • value  80314200
    address  1CN5VEduyfGLr1tsKooVp9gAvHgs8UPATs
  • aebc52e07144adc102733b6d43dae6baf95175ce7f4ff68340fd427c88f27748:1
  • value  2181812
    address  3ALYcJxvfL8APtjqqPtaBe8bvuHeNN6Yi1